Item #: SCP-4657
Object Class: Keter
Special Containment Procedures: SCP-4657 is to be contained within a solid steel, 7 ft x 7 ft x 7 ft air and water tight cube. This cell will have one access port: A sealed vault style door roughly the size of an entire wall of the containment zone. The interior walls of the cell are to be fully covered and padded with standard RFID signal blocking fabric. In the center of this cell is a folding table made of aluminum, which SCP-4657 is to rest upon. At the top of the northern wall of cell is an air vent, with a standard style grate covering, which leads to an exterior compartment from the cell. In this compartment is an industrial fan and several access ports which can hold multiple oxygen tanks at a time. The hatch that accesses this port is available from outside of the cell, allowing Foundation personnel to access and replace oxygen safely without contact of SCP-4657. When required, on-site personnel will remotely close the ventilation grate within the cell in order to safely replace empty oxygen tanks and resume the air conditioning of the cell. Lastly, a high quality RFID or drone signal jamming device is to be left in the southwestern corner of the cell, that can be remotely activated in case of facility-wide containment breaches to insure that SCP-4657 does not breach it's cell.
Description: SCP-4657 is a globally unknown parasitic bacteria that festers on whatever surface it is currently given, which is typically a petri dish set upon the table within its cell. This bacteria is highly infectious, and is quite resistant to extreme temperature, both hot and cold. It is currently suggested that in this form, SCP-4657 is possibly not sentient, or at least unintelligent, given its bacterial state.
SCP-4657 is, if given the chance, highly infectious and aggressive, attempting to spread to any living host in its vicinity. When its bacterial form reaches a potential host, it will begin to enter the body's immune system and overwhelm its defenses, rendering the host incapable of independently fighting back. SCP-4657 will then attempt and typically succeed in entering the host's brain and accessing the entire body, taking full control. At this point, SCP-4657 will then use the body functions and resources of the host to begin its transformation.
The transformation of SCP-4657 is fast and aggressive, typically taking between 30 minutes to 1 hour to fully complete, depending on the host's current medical support. The body of the host, human or otherwise, will begin to stretch, malform, and cause it's internal structure to protrude and disfigure at a rapid pace. At this point, if the host is human, they will have entirely lost their ability to speak for themselves, fight back, or otherwise attempt to communicate or struggle. The body of the host after transformation will always look relatively different from other specimens, but always attempt to retain a bulbous, vaguely humanoid form consisting of larger than usual body parts, excess fat, and thick or wiry muscles.
Once a host has been transformed, they are then referred to as SCP-4657-1. Instances of SCP-4657-1 are nearly always reported to attempt gutteral, inhuman vocalization, although in the English language. They typically speak about themselves, referring to them in third person speech, and calling themselves "bagrid". The usual sentences spoken are roughly understood to mean that these organisms all attempt to meet at a specific, unknown location in [DATA EXPUNGED]. From there it is understood that instances of "bagrid" desire to merge with eachother to "complete itself" and [DATA REDACTED].
Due to the fact that "bagrid" is known to be located in multiple areas around the globe, it is considered highly dangerous, and any sightings reported will result in immediate search of the area, MTF forces dispatched to handle the transformed threat, and research personnel to attempt to locate any remaining bacterial forms of SCP-4657 through the use of [DATA EXPUNGED], and bring it safely to containment with the rest of its kind.
Instances of SCP-4657-1 are known to be highly resilient and extremely deadly, often using excess bone and sinew to form weapon-like appendages on its arms or legs, utilizing them to tremendous affect in combat. Armed personnel tasked with the termination and containment of SCP-4657-1 are to be briefed on this information and armed with heavy weaponry and [DATA EXPUNGED]. However, the bulbous form, excess mass and slow metabolism of SCP-4657-1 instances work in favor of the Foundation, allowing use of aerial combat and long ranged weaponry to find and neutralize the threat they pose with relative ease.
Rarely, however, instances of SCP-4657-1 are known to utilize excess mass to elongate appendages for use against aerial vehicles or personnel at a medium distance.
